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
可以存在空的虚拟表吗?
include
c
virtual
vtable
iOS6 中的 CoreMIDI/PGMidi 虚拟 midi 错误
面临两个错误 此代码在 iOS 4 和 5 中有效 但更新到 6 后 它不起作用 我发现了以下内容 但不知道如何在代码中修复它 从 iOS 6 开始 应用程序需要在其 UIBackgroundModes 中拥有音频键才能使用 CoreMID
virtual
MIDI
coremidi
在.NET中编写虚拟打印机[关闭]
Closed 这个问题正在寻求书籍 工具 软件库等的推荐 不满足堆栈溢出指南 help closed questions 目前不接受答案 我希望创建一个虚拟打印机 将数据传递到我的 NET 应用程序 然后我想创建一个安装程序来安装打印机和
NET
virtual
printing
虚拟、覆盖、新建和密封覆盖之间的区别
我对 OOP 的一些概念很困惑 virtual override new and sealed override 谁能解释一下这些差异吗 我很清楚 如果要使用派生类方法 可以使用override关键字使得基类方法将被派生类覆盖 但我不确定n
c
OOP
overriding
virtual
newoperator
C++虚函数被隐藏
我在 C 继承方面遇到问题 我有一个类层次结构 class A public virtual void onFoo virtual void onFoo int i class B public A public virtual void
c
inheritance
virtual
C++ vtable 通过虚拟继承进行解析
我对 C 和虚拟继承很好奇 特别是解决低音类和子类之间 vtable 冲突的方式 我不会假装了解它们如何工作的具体细节 但到目前为止我所看到的是 由于该分辨率 使用虚拟函数会导致一些小的延迟 我的问题是基类是否为空 即它的虚拟函数定义为 v
c
virtual
virtualfunctions
vtable
未使用的私有虚拟方法是否允许将来扩展而不破坏 ABI 兼容性?
我正在开发一个共享库 假设我有以下类定义 class MyClass public public interface private virtual void foo1 int virtual void foo2 int bool virt
c
virtual
backwardscompatibility
状态模式 C++
在遵循这里的一些优秀教程之后 我正在尝试创建一个简单的状态模式 http gameprogrammingpatterns com state html http gameprogrammingpatterns com state html
c
class
virtual
statepattern
当使用“override”或“final”说明符时,“virtual”关键字不是多余的吗?
假设我有以下基类 class Base public virtual void f 如果我想写一个类来重写f 并且不允许将其覆盖到其派生类可以使用以下方法编写它 方法一 class Derived public Base public vi
c
overriding
virtual
final
为什么“虚拟”对于派生类中的重写方法是可选的?
当一个方法被声明为virtual在类中 会自动考虑其在派生类中的重写virtual同样 C 语言使此关键字virtual在这种情况下可选 class Base virtual void f class Derived public Base
c
virtual
derivedclass
虚函数的实现可以放在头文件中吗
通常 如果我们将非虚拟成员函数的实现放入头文件中 该函数将被内联 如果我们将虚拟成员函数的实现放在头文件中怎么样 我想这与将其放入 cpp 文件中是一样的 因为内联和多态性不能一起工作 我的说法正确吗 将方法的实现放入头文件中并不会使其内联
c
header
virtual
inline
虚拟的概念
我对 CPP 很陌生 正在学习后期绑定多态性 根据我所阅读和理解的内容 virtual 关键字用于后期绑定 它在编译时内部创建一个由 vptr 指向的 vtable 所以 例如 class BASE public virtual void
c
inheritance
virtual
在子类中将非纯虚函数变成纯虚函数
所以 我有这个多态层次结构 ClassA Is not abstract no pure virtual functions but a few virtual functions ClassB public ClassA Defines
c
polymorphism
virtual
通过Asp.net背后的代码访问虚拟目录文件夹
我正在尝试从代码隐藏访问虚拟目录文件夹 ASP Net 网站名称 SuperImages 物理文件夹 C images 虚拟目录文件夹 allimages 与App Data Scripts Properties文件夹处于同一级别 我正在尝
aspnet
directory
virtual
如何通过基类指针调用派生类的虚函数
我们来看看这段代码 class CBase public virtual vfunc cout lt lt CBase vfunc lt lt endl class CChild public CBase public vfunc cout
c
inheritance
pointers
virtual
Radix
C++ 参数协方差
我想知道为什么 C 不支持参数的协方差 如下例所示 或者是否有办法实现它 class base public virtual base func base ptr return new base class derived public b
c
virtual
covariance
用于 Twain 开发的模拟或虚拟 Twain 源 [关闭]
Closed 这个问题是无关 help closed questions 目前不接受答案 为了开发基于 Web 的扫描解决方案 我很乐意在 Windows 或 Mac 上测试它 而无需实际将扫描仪连接到我的盒子上 那么是否有一个程序 工具可
Testing
virtual
twain
emulation
函数声明中缺少“虚拟”限定符
在搜寻一些旧代码时 我遇到了类似于以下内容的内容 class Base public virtual int Func class Derived public Base public int Func Missing virtual qu
c
inheritance
virtual
虚函数表偏移量
我想问一下 类的虚函数表的偏移量取决于什么 我的意思是 从我读到的内容来看 它至少取决于编译器 但它是否因类而异 编辑 通过偏移我的意思是表相对于所有者对象的地址的位置 编辑 示例代码 void vtable void char objec
c
function
virtual
抽象类:成员函数“virtual...”的抽象返回类型无效
在我的程序中 我有这样的类层次结构 include
c
virtual
abstractclass
«
1
2
3
4
5
6
7
»